Package io.pravega.connectors.flink
Class PravegaInputSplit
- java.lang.Object
-
- io.pravega.connectors.flink.PravegaInputSplit
-
- All Implemented Interfaces:
java.io.Serializable
,org.apache.flink.core.io.InputSplit
public class PravegaInputSplit extends java.lang.Object implements org.apache.flink.core.io.InputSplit
APravegaInputSplit
corresponds to a PravegaSegmentRange
.- See Also:
- Serialized Form
-
-
Constructor Summary
Constructors Constructor Description PravegaInputSplit(int splitId, io.pravega.client.batch.SegmentRange segmentRange)
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description boolean
equals(java.lang.Object o)
io.pravega.client.batch.SegmentRange
getSegmentRange()
int
getSplitNumber()
int
hashCode()
java.lang.String
toString()
-
-
-
Method Detail
-
getSplitNumber
public int getSplitNumber()
- Specified by:
getSplitNumber
in interfaceorg.apache.flink.core.io.InputSplit
-
getSegmentRange
public io.pravega.client.batch.SegmentRange getSegmentRange()
-
equals
public boolean equals(java.lang.Object o)
- Overrides:
equals
in classjava.lang.Object
-
hashCode
public int hashCode()
- Overrides:
hashCode
in classjava.lang.Object
-
toString
public java.lang.String toString()
- Overrides:
toString
in classjava.lang.Object
-
-